Fried Mac and Cheese Bites: Indulgent Turkey Bacon Delight
Fried Mac and Cheese Bites are the perfect indulgent snack, combining creamy cheese with crispy turkey bacon.

- 2 cups cooked macaroni
- 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
- 1 cup crumbled turkey bacon
- 1 cup breadcrumbs
- 2 large eggs
- 1 cup flour
- 2 cups vegetable oil (for frying)
- In a large bowl, mix the cooked macaroni, cheddar cheese, and turkey bacon until well combined.
- Form the mixture into small balls and set aside.
- Prepare three bowls: one with flour, one with beaten eggs, and one with breadcrumbs.
- Roll each ball in flour, dip in eggs, and coat with breadcrumbs.
- In a deep pan, heat the vegetable oil over medium heat.
- Fry the cheese balls until golden brown, then remove and drain on paper towels.
- Serve warm with your favorite dipping sauce.
